1. INTRODUCTION
1.1 General Description
This document specifies a complete data radio module that will support the company’s next generation of PCMCIA based handheld and vehicle mount terminal, base station, access point and ruggedized computer products. The radio specified herein shall provide full support for, and be backwards compatible with the company’s proprietary narrowband radio protocols which include 4800 and 9600 baud two level FM, and 4800, 9600 and 19,200 baud four level FM. Specific host products that this radio is required to support are listed below under Host Support. Included as part of this support are the appropriate software drivers that will reside on the host. Connection to the host computer system shall be restricted to the standards governing a PCMCIA type III PC card. The traditional radio deck, interface card and flex cable will be
integrated into a single type III PC card and connected via a cable to the host antenna.
This document represents the prime revision-controlled description of the project, the product and its requirements and will be updated throughout the life of the project. A list of all relevant documents and drawings is included as the main reference for the project.

3. DETAILED FEATURE AND FUNCTIONAL REQUIREMENTS
3.1 General
The RA1001 shall provide narrowband data communications using all Teklogix proprietary narrowband FM protocols and modulation schemes, which include 2 level FM running at 4800 and 9600 baud, and 4 level FM running at 4800, 9600 and 19,200 bps. It shall be functionally backward compatible with existing Teklogix narrowband radios including the TRX7340, TRX7345, TRX7355 and TRX7370.
The implementation shall be modular and consist of a PCMCIA form factor interface card, incorporating the radio deck, an external antenna system and an antenna connecting cable. The latter, along with appropriate mounting hardware shall be custom designed for each target host as required and will not be covered under this specification.
The interface card shall provide the stack protocol, control the radio, acquire and provide transmitted and received data streams via the PCMCIA interface, carry out all appropriate signal processing, encoding, decoding and control functions required to properly transmit and receive data via the radio. The PC Card interface shall conform as closely as possible to the PC-Card 95 Type III standard. Deviations from the standard must not affect in any way the compatibility of the RA1001 with any Teklogix host products.
3.2 Host Support
The RA1001 shall function per specification when installed in the following Teklogix PCMCIA
based host products:
Teklogix 7530 NG Handheld Terminal (WinCE.net operating system)
Teklogix 8525 NG Vehicle Mount Terminal (WinCE.net operating system)
Teklogix 8560/70 Vehicle Mounted Terminal (Win2K/XP operating system)
Use of the RA1001 in the following Teklogix PCMCIA based products is considered to be
beyond the scope of this project.
Teklogix 7035 Compact Handheld Terminal (DOS operating system)
Teklogix 9150 Access Point (VxWorks operating system)
Teklogix 8255/60 Vehicle Mounted Terminal (DOS operating system)
Software drivers for the indicated terminals / operating systems will be provided. The RA1001 shall also be designed to accommodate where possible other portable and mobile computers that support a PCMCIA type III slot.
